Question 3 of Assignment 1

To make telephone numbers easier to remember, some companies use letters to show their telephone number. For example, using letters, the telephone number 438-5626 can be show as GET LOAN. In some cases, to make a telephone number meaningful, companies might use more than seven letters. For example, 225-5466 can be displayed as CALL HOME, which uses eight letters.

Write a program that prompts the user to enter a telephone number expressed in letters and outputs the corresponding telephone number in digits. If the user enters more than 7 letters, then process only the first seven letters. Also output the -(hyphen) after the third digit. Allow the user to use both uppercase and lowercase letters as well as spaces between words.

Question 1

Modify question 3 of Assignment 1 to accept a telephone number with any number of letters. The output should display a hyphen after the first 3 digits and subsequently a hyphen (-) after every four digits. Also, modify the program to process as many telephone numbers as the user wants.
